One Nationally Ranked Program, Two Campuses
Our undergraduate degree program is offered on the University of Nebraska Omaha campus, University of Nebraska Lincoln campus, and online. Students actively collaborate to understand the causes and consequences of crime, the criminal justice system's response to crime, and develop innovative and effective solutions to enhancing community safety.
- Research opportunities are available through the Victimology and Victim Studies Research Lab (VVSRL), Violence Intervention and Policing Research (VIPR) Lab, Nebraska Collaborative for Violence Intervention and Prevention (NeCVIP), Crime and Justice Public Opinion Lab (CJPOL), and affiliated research centers including the Nebraska Center for Justice Research, the Juvenile Justice Institute, and the National Counterterrorism Innovation, Technology and Education Center.
- Internships are available to junior/senior undergraduates and master's students with local and federal criminal justice agencies including the Drug Enforcement Administration, U.S. Secret Service, Omaha Police Department, Nebraska Probation Department, and the Nebraska Department of Correctional Services. Criminal justice community organizations also have internships available. Competitive opportunities for paid internships exist!
- Gain international perspective through our London Study Abroad program.
- Our bachelor's (#17), master's (#5), and doctoral degree (#13) programs are recognized as top-ranked criminology and criminal justice programs by the U.S. News and World Report.
